Stringent Safety and Regulatory Standards
The rising demands from governmental agencies and regulatory bodies compel industries to meet strict safety requirements which makes failure analysis essential for compliance. The automotive aerospace and energy sectors together with other industries need to perform routine failure analysis examinations to satisfy their safety quality and performance requirements. Failure analysis service demand increases due to regulatory pressure because the analysis helps organizations identify potential risks to reduce liability risks while improving customer trust. The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and the European Union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) have set stringent failure analysis and testing standards to ensure aircraft safety in the aerospace sector. Furthermore, automotive industry reports show that the Takata airbags recall serves as an essential demonstration of failure analysis significance in the sector because hundreds of millions of U.S. vehicles received the defective airbag design that led to dangerous explosions triggering fatal injuries. Besides this, regulatory standards and public safety measures require extensive failure analysis, which enhances the failure analysis market outlook.

The scanning electron microscope (SEM) represents the largest market segment with 38.9% share. SEM provides high-resolution imaging at the microscopic level, which is critical for discovering and investigating material defects. Its capacity to record specific surface details and detect abnormalities like cracks, fractures, and other flaws makes it useful in a variety of sectors, including electronics, aerospace, and automotive. The SEM's versatility in studying both conductive and non-conductive materials, as well as its ability to do elemental analysis using energy-dispersive X-ray spectroscopy (EDS), contribute to its supremacy in failure analysis applications. As companies focus quality control and defect avoidance, demand for SEM in failure analysis is projected to stay strong, fueling market expansion.
The secondary ion mass spectrometry (SIMS)segment holds the largest market share due to its unmatched sensitivity in detecting trace elements and contaminants. SIMS is widely used in the semiconductor industry for depth profiling and surface analysis, ensuring precise defect detection in microelectronics and nanotechnology. Its ability to analyze thin films and detect low-concentration impurities makes it crucial for quality control in industries like aerospace, automotive, and medical devices. Additionally, SIMS supports advancements in material science by providing detailed chemical composition analysis. As industries demand higher precision and reliability, the adoption of SIMS continues to grow, reinforcing its dominance in the failure analysis market.
